Programs

3 programs

Memphis oral school for the deaf (mosd) offers an early intervention educational preschool for students five days a week. It emphasizes individual progress in speech and auditory skills from ages 2 to 6. It empowers children with hearing loss or hard of hearing who rely on assistive listening devices to have equal access to communication. The preschool is an eleven (11) month program that provides a comprehensive approach to enhance their learning through listening and spoken language (lsl) to help the children maintain and develop the skills needed to achieve their full potential. The school annually serves approximately 30 students in an academic year.

The speech & hearing center of the midsouth provides community speech therapy and audiological services in a traditional clinical setting. Services are extended to those attending the mosd early intervention educational preschool program on a weekly basis while the student is attending classes and those enrolled in the developmental therapy as outside clients. One unique clinical program, the sound beginnings program, is designed to offer one-on-one speech therapy for children with a parent education and training component to enhance child language and parent training development. This program is a building block to enrollment into the sound transition program. The sound beginnings clinical program provided services for approximately 40 clients in 2023-2024. Families in mosd's other programs utilize the center's providers annually as part of their enrolled students' individualized family service plan (ifsp) goals. Additionally, the speech-language pathologists conduct speech evaluations in company, with the audiologists providing cochlear mapping and hearing aid adjustments. Additionally, we outsource our services to partner schools in shelby county, and we currently have one speech-language pathologist from our center who managed a caseload of approximately 40 students who required speech therapy from lausanne collegiate school.

Lastly, during the year, including the population from mosd's programs, the speech & hearing center served approximately 550 residents in the mid-south.
